How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hacker Valley?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hacker Valley Studio Apartments | $487 | $487 | $487 |
| Hacker Valley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,116 | $485 | $2,796 |
| Hacker Valley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,274 | $595 | $3,128 |
| Hacker Valley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,427 | $816 | $2,400 |
| Hacker Valley 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,762 | $2,475 | $3,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Hacker Valley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Hacker Valley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Hacker Valley is $2,152.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Hacker Valley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Hacker Valley is a 3,029 square feet unit starting from $1,395 at Eagle View Luxury Apartments.
What is the average size for Hacker Valley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Hacker Valley is currently at 747 sq ft.
